I needed a bridesmaids dress fitted for a wedding and live just down the street so I figured I’d give it a try. When dropping off the dress she was very meticulous about the measurements to ensure the alterations were done correctly. She was very sweet and I was quickly put at ease as I was nervous to take an expensive and important dress to a place that I was unfamiliar with. Plus the cost of alterations was pretty reasonable. $ 95 to take the dress in, adjust the straps, and take a few inches off the bottom. I picked up the dress about 3 weeks later, tried it on and the alterations were a bit off but nothing I couldn’t handle. It was a bit snug under the armpit but I can deal with it knowing I only have to wear the dress once. Then I turned around to notice that she burned the whole back of my dress with the steamer. The seams from under the dress are 100% visible on the outside and just above the butt are scratches in the material. I don’t know what the heck she did, but it looks awful. She insisted nothing was there and that«she saw nothing». Of course she would say that. She just ruined a $ 300 dress. At this point in time I’m not able to order a new one so I have to be the bridesmaid wearing a shawl to cover up a burnt dress. I really did like/try to like Mina as a sweet lady and to support a local small business but you cannot completely botch a service and still be asked to pay…

I have been frequenting Mina’s for alterations since I moved to the area twelve years ago. I have never used another tailor in my life, so I am not an expert on quality but Mina seems to do a good job. My sister introduced me to Mina when she had her wedding dress altered. Since then, I have had several bridesmaids dresses altered, a coat alerted, many pairs of pants altered, and of course buttons reattached. Mina’s is located on Columbia Pike between Burger King and The Broiler. It’s on the second floor of a run-down building above a barber shop. If you blink, you will miss it. I assume her business exists by word of mouth. The space is very small and unassuming and appears to be her home away from home. Mina works alone and the turnaround time is typically one week although she is flexible. The prices are reasonable. For example, when I need pants altered she typically has to take apart the pant legs at the seams and reattach them, for a cost of approximately $ 20. She tends to add in some freebies such as button reattachment or other quick alterations. It’s always a comedy show when I stop by to have my pants altered. Without fail, I depart the dressing room with my ill-fitting pants and say«these pants are too big in the butt» to which she says«I dooooon’t think sooooo…» After some negotiation, she agrees to make the alterations. When I return after one week to try them on, I am always pleased and then typically tell her I have about 20 more pairs to bring in, to which she responds…“that’s cause you like your pants that way”…meaning snug in the bum. I mean, who wants to wear saggy pants? But yes, I get that she thinks I wear my pants inappropriately. Parking is a little tough. I usually park in the Burger King parking lot and run in quickly. Mina’s is a good bet if you live close by and tend to like mom and pop establishments.
